Output 3c615343ac64f12abec67364c5149b421bd98b567ab725eccb491f0f7e312f22:0
- value
- 1531187550
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fe3564b6166932762497b095b82eb840cdc1fe80 OP_EQUAL
- address
- AFcQFxFQbZQi9C8HsDLEttSqfWSv4bih1a
- transaction
- 3c615343ac64f12abec67364c5149b421bd98b567ab725eccb491f0f7e312f22